> I wanted to mention, that Goof-Off is a much "hotter"
> formulation than "Goo-Gone", and is MUCH MORE LIKELY
> to damage plastic. With any solvent, test it if
> possible before using! However, I've never had
> Goo-Gone damage plastic. Goof-Off, yes!

  Goof-Off is some extreme stuff. It WILL melt most case plastics, for
example, enough to make it flexible in about 35 seconds.
  The other thing nobody's mentioned about both products is that they're
highly toxic [0]. Especially with Goof-Off, I finally quit believing
that "just this one thing" idea. If the cap's coming off the bottle,
it's under the exhaust hood or outside.
